Christopher Fryの名言
Between our birth and death we may touch understanding, As a moth brushes a window with its wing.
Comedy is an escape, not from truth but from despair; a narrow escape into faith.
Imagination is the wide-open eye which leads us always to see truth more vividly.
In my plays I want to look at life - at the commonplace of existence-as if we had just turned a corner and run into it for the first time.
Life is a hypocrite if I can't live The way it moves me!
Poetry is the language in which man explores his own amazement.
The first of our senses which we should take care never to let rust through disuse is that sixth sense, the imagination. I mean the wide-open eye which leads us to see truth more vividly, to apprehend more broadly, to concern ourselves more deeply, to be, all our life long, sensitive and awake to the powers and responsibilities given to us as human beings.
The moon is nothing But a circumambulating aphrodisiac Divinely subsidized to provoke the world Into a rising birth-rate
Try thinking of love, or something. Amor vincit insomnia.
